Understanding costs when choosing an interactive projection solution
The question of interactive floor projection system cost is rarely answered with a single number. Buyers — from museums and retail chains to schools and event producers — need a feature-aware cost model to estimate true project budgets. This article explains how individual features drive price, offers typical cost ranges, and gives practical purchasing guidance so you can plan budgets, evaluate vendors, and forecast ROI with confidence.
Primary cost drivers for interactive floor projection systems (interactive floor projection system cost)
When forecasting an interactive floor projection system cost, focus on these primary drivers: projector hardware, interaction sensors, software & licensing, content creation, installation & mounting, and ongoing support & warranty. Each driver affects both upfront capital expenditure (CapEx) and recurring operational expense (OpEx). Understanding their relative impact helps prioritize investment for performance and longevity.
Projector hardware: brightness, resolution, and throw (interactive floor projection system cost)
Projectors often account for 30–50% of initial hardware spend. Key specs that change price rapidly are brightness (lumens), resolution (WUXGA, 4K), and throw type (ultra-short-throw vs standard/long-throw). Higher brightness and 4K resolution increase costs but also expand venue flexibility (ambient light tolerance and large projection areas). Ultra-short-throw lenses and laser light sources add High Quality but reduce installation complexity and maintenance.
Interaction sensors and tracking technologies (interactive floor projection system cost)
Sensors convert physical movement into system input. Options include overhead RGB or depth cameras (e.g., Intel RealSense, Microsoft Kinect-class), infrared arrays, LIDAR, and floor pressure mats. Camera-based systems provide rich tracking and multi-user scenarios but require more processing and calibration. Sensor choice affects both hardware cost and software complexity—camera suites and depth sensors typically raise system cost more than simple IR or mat sensors.
Software platform and licensing (interactive floor projection system cost)
Software drives interactivity and content logic. Commercial-grade interactive platforms include content engines, tracking fusion, calibration tools, and management dashboards. Licensing models vary: perpetual license + maintenance, subscription SaaS, or per-seat/per-install fees. Custom software or bespoke integrations increase upfront development costs and ongoing maintenance obligations. Factor anticipated updates and multi-site management when estimating software costs.
Content creation and custom experiences (interactive floor projection system cost)
Content ranges from templated games to bespoke, brand-aligned experiences with 3D assets and audio design. Simple templates lower cost dramatically; custom content creation (storyboarding, animation, sound design, UX testing) can exceed hardware costs for a single installation. Many organizations allocate an ongoing content budget to refresh experiences seasonally, which should be included in total cost of ownership (TCO).
Installation, structural work & mounting (interactive floor projection system cost)
Installation costs depend on site complexity: ceiling height, environmental constraints (outdoor, wet floors), required housings, safety compliance, and cabling. Ultra-short-throw systems may reduce structural costs; long-throw setups can require rigging or custom housings that add labor fees. Professional calibration and on-site testing are critical and typically charged separately from hardware.
Support, warranty & lifecycle management (interactive floor projection system cost)
Extended warranties, remote monitoring, and SLAs affect OpEx. Manufacturer-backed service contracts reduce downtime risk but increase annual costs. Consider spare parts strategy (hot-swappable components) for high-uptime environments; this raises initial inventory costs but reduces event-critical failure risk.
Feature-to-cost comparison: typical price impacts (interactive floor projection system cost)
The table below summarizes how specific features typically influence purchase price. Use it to map your required capabilities to realistic budget tiers.
| Feature | Low-end impact (approx.) | Mid-range impact (approx.) | High-end impact (approx.) | Cost driver notes |
|---|---|---|---|---|
| Projector (lumens/resolution) | $500–$2,000 | $2,000–$8,000 | $8,000–$30,000+ | Higher lumens & 4K/laser are expensive but enable larger/ambient-lit spaces. |
| Sensors (tracking) | $200–$800 | $800–$3,000 | $3,000–$10,000+ | Depth cameras and multi-camera fusion cost more than single IR sensors or mats. |
| Software & licenses | $0–$1,000 | $1,000–$10,000 | $10,000–$50,000+ | Perpetual vs subscription vs custom; multi-site management increases price. |
| Content & UX | $0–$2,000 | $2,000–$15,000 | $15,000–$100,000+ | Custom narratives, 3D assets and testing raise costs significantly. |
| Installation & calibration | $200–$1,000 | $1,000–$8,000 | $8,000–$40,000+ | Site complexity and safety requirements increase labor and materials. |
| Support & warranty (annual) | $50–$300 | $300–$2,000 | $2,000–$10,000+ | Higher SLAs and onsite support costs more; remote monitoring reduces price. |
Typical turnkey budget tiers (interactive floor projection system cost)
Below are typical turnkey cost ranges for a full interactive floor projection installation (hardware, basic software, installation, and one content package). These are representative market brackets for planning — refine with vendor quotes.
| Tier | Suitable for | Estimated turnkey cost |
|---|---|---|
| Entry | Small classrooms, pop-up events, small retail | $1,000–$6,000 |
| Professional | Museums, mid-size retail, themed entertainment | $6,000–$35,000 |
| Enterprise / Large Scale | Immersive rooms, projection shows, permanent exhibits | $35,000–$250,000+ |
How to evaluate total cost of ownership (interactive floor projection system cost)
TCO includes CapEx and OpEx across a defined lifecycle (commonly 3–7 years). Key elements to model: initial purchase, installation, training, annual software subscriptions, content refresh cycles, maintenance/service contracts, consumables (if lamps used), and depreciation for capital budgeting. For public-facing installations, factor opportunity costs such as downtime during maintenance and seasonal variations in use.
Procurement checklist to control costs (interactive floor projection system cost)
Use a procurement checklist to avoid hidden costs: 1) Define interaction goals and user capacity; 2) Specify ambient light and projection size to pick projector lumen/resolution; 3) Choose sensor tech matching tracking resolution and multi-user needs; 4) Clarify software license model and update cadence; 5) Budget for content refresh and A/B testing; 6) Require SLAs and spare parts; 7) Ask vendors for itemized quotes with installation, travel, and calibration fees; 8) Compare total lifecycle costs not just initial price.
Real-world scenarios and cost examples (interactive floor projection system cost)
Scenario pricing helps translate features into budgets. Below are three anonymized examples reflecting common use cases and cost drivers.
| Scenario | Key features | Estimated turnkey cost | >
|---|---|---|
| Small classroom install | 1 x 4,000-lumen short-throw projector, single IR sensor, template software, basic install | $1,500–$4,500 |
| Museum interactive floor | 1 x 8,000-lumen WUXGA laser projector, depth camera, custom content, professional install | $12,000–$45,000 |
| Large immersive space | Multi-projector blend, redundancy, multi-camera tracking fusion, custom 3D content, show control | $75,000–$300,000+ |
ROI and KPIs to justify interactive floor investment (interactive floor projection system cost)
Measure ROI using KPIs aligned to your objective: dwell time (museums/retail), conversion uplift (retail/brand activations), engagement sessions per day (parks/events), education outcomes (schools), and media exposure value. For commercial deployments, estimate incremental revenue per visit and compare against amortized system cost over expected life (e.g., 5 years). High-engagement installations often justify higher initial spend through measurable behavioral lift.
Manufacturer selection and vendor negotiation tips (interactive floor projection system cost)
Choose vendors with relevant case studies for your vertical. Ask for site visits, references, and uptime statistics. Negotiate bundled pricing (hardware + first-year software + content) and include acceptance testing milestones. Insist on calibration training and remote diagnostics tools. For multi-site rollouts, request volume discounts and standardized BOMs to reduce per-site cost.

Practical tips to reduce interactive floor projection system cost without sacrificing performance
1) Start with a pilot using mid-range hardware and template content to validate engagement metrics. 2) Choose laser projectors where uptime and low maintenance offset higher upfront cost. 3) Use modular designs so upgrades (e.g., adding cameras) are incremental. 4) Negotiate bundled service and content refresh packages. 5) Plan for remote diagnostic tools to lower onsite service calls.
FAQs
Q1: How much does an interactive floor projection system cost on average?
A1: Average turnkey costs typically range from $1,000 for very small installs to $250,000+ for large immersive experiences. Mid-range museum or retail installations commonly fall between $6,000 and $35,000. Exact costs depend on projector specs, sensor systems, software licensing, content, and installation complexity.
Q2: Which feature increases price the most?
A2: High-end projection hardware (high lumen counts and 4K resolution) and bespoke content production usually have the largest single impact. Multi-camera tracking fusion and enterprise-class software licensing can also contribute substantially.
Q3: Can I reduce costs by using consumer projectors?
A3: Consumer projectors lower upfront costs but often lack brightness, ruggedness, warranty coverage, and uptime required for public installations. For low-use or trial deployments, they are acceptable; for permanent, high-traffic sites, commercial/installation-grade projectors are recommended to reduce long-term OpEx.
Q4: How should I budget for content updates?
A4: Budget for at least one content refresh per year for public or retail deployments. Costs vary widely: template refreshes can be <$2,000, while major seasonal campaigns or custom 3D content can exceed $15,000.
Q5: Is subscription software more cost-effective than perpetual licensing?
A5: Subscription models lower upfront capital, include updates, and can be ideal for smaller budgets. Perpetual licenses with maintenance fees can be cheaper long-term if you plan many years of use. Model both options over your expected lifecycle to decide.

What about the wall/floor material for the projection?
It’s recommended to choose a light-colored material with minimal reflectivity—pure white or light grey works best. the
common material is cement & plaster board
For optimal projection results, the surface should be free of any patterns or textures, as the projector will display content
directly onto it.
There are no specific material requirements; you may use any commonly available material in your local market, as long as it
meets the above conditions.
